WALS Foundation The WALS foundation was established in 2004 to promote education, economic opportunity, and environmental sustainability in Wheeling, WV.

One of our symposium guests is offering workshops at the MoJo!

Join us Labor Day weekend at the MoJo for this hands on workshop!

See how textile artist Tabitha Arnold uses a punch needle as an embroidery tool as you create your own small embroidery. You can keep your finished piece or contribute it to a collective tapestry that will grow over time in multiple cities across the US.

There are two opportunities to participate in this 3-hr workshop - each session is a standalone experience.

These workshops are offered in partnership with the WALS Foundation's Reuther-Pollack Labor Symposium, where Arnold is a featured presenter this year.
